About SVA Quarterly Income Statement

What this statement shows

This page presents issuer-reported income statement data, detailing revenue, operating costs, expenses, and earnings as disclosed in SEC 10-Q filings and standardized by CSIMarket. The income statement reflects operating performance over a reporting period rather than financial position at a single date.

Revenue and expense treatment

Revenue and expense items are aligned to support period-to-period comparability. Operating and non-operating items, interest, and income taxes are classified based on issuer disclosures and XBRL tagging.
